RAMALLAH, November 29, 2024 (WAFA) - The Palestinian Presidency condemned on Friday the relentless Israeli massacres in the Gaza Strip, with the latest atrocity in Beit Lahia claiming over 100 lives and leaving dozens injured, including women and children.
Presidential spokesperson Nabil Abu Rudeineh accused the Israeli authorities of pursuing aggressive policies to forcibly displace Palestinians and sever northern Gaza from the rest of the Strip through continuing its ongoing genocide and the starvation war in Gaza, in addition to the settler-backed violence and attacks on villages and refugee camps in the West Bank.
Abu Rudeineh stressed that the Palestinian people will remain steadfast in their commitment to the unity of all Palestinian territories within the framework of the State of Palestine, whether in Gaza, the West Bank, or Jerusalem; the capital.
He affirmed that such plans for displacement would fail in the face of strong Palestinian resilience and widespread Arab and international opposition.
Abu Rudeineh urged the international community to intervene and pressure the Israeli authorities to end their aggression and genocidal crimes against the Palestinian people.
He emphasized the need to uphold international law, particularly Resolution 2735, which demands an immediate ceasefire, unrestricted humanitarian aid access to Gaza and the empowerment of the State of Palestine to fulfill its responsibilities.
He further cautioned that inaction would only sustain the cycle of violence in the region, preventing security and stability for all.
The presidential spokesperson held the U.S. administration fully responsible for the continuation of this bloody aggression, citing its provision of political cover that allows Israeli occupation authorities to evade accountability.
He also highlighted the continued U.S. financial and military support, which empowers Israel to disregard international law, including the recent UN General Assembly resolution urging the implementation of the International Court of Justice's advisory opinion to stop the aggression and end the Israeli occupation.
